Burglars damage fireplace and wardrobe in Hazelbank break-in

Burglars damaged a fireplace and a wardrobe before making off with a piece of jewellery in a break-in in Hazelbank earlier this week.

Police are appealing for information following the report of the burglary at a house in the Rosskeen area.

Sometime between Tuesday, November 29, and 10.30am on Thursday, December 1 entry was gained to a house and a piece of jewellery stolen.

Damage was also caused to the fireplace and a wardrobe.
